Special Education Services That Meet Students Where They Are
Students who qualify for special education services under IDEA receive individualized support based on their unique learning needs. Our team works with families to implement each student’s IEP and provide specially designed instruction, progress monitoring, and ongoing collaboration.
Services may be delivered virtually through scheduled appointments, webcam, phone, and other appropriate supports based on the student’s plan and team decisions. In addition to our services, students and families can meet with our transition specialist to develop a plan for post-secondary education or vocational training and employment.

Accommodations That Remove Barriers to Learning
Students eligible under Section 504 receive accommodations designed to provide equal access to learning. Our team works with families and students to create plans that support success while helping students fully participate in school and make progress in the general education curriculum.
